What to expect

Youth Affairs Council Victoria (YACVic)'s Board of Governance warmly invites you to RSVP for the 2022 YACVic Annual General Meeting (AGM). 

Throughout this year of ongoing challenges from COVID-19 as well as a federal and state election, YACVic has continued to work with and alongside you to advocate on the issues affecting young people and the youth sector. 

Join our AGM for a chance to connect with your peers, celebrate the sector’s work, and look towards the future.

This year's AGM will also feature the announcement of newly elected board members (see nominations info below), and a diverse panel of young people speaking about their experiences of support from youth workers. You can find out more about board nominations and nominating yourself here.
